High-Speed Portable Power for Your DJI Devices
The DJI 65W Portable Charger is designed to deliver fast, reliable charging while remaining compact and easy to carry. Using advanced GaN technology, it achieves faster charging speeds without increasing size or weight. The charger features a fixed USB-C cable and a USB-A output port, allowing you to charge a battery and a remote controller simultaneously. With support for PPS and PD protocols, it’s versatile enough to charge not just DJI devices, but also smartphones, laptops, and other USB-powered electronics. Universal Input Voltage – Works with 100-240 V, 2 A, 50/60 Hz power sources.
-
High Power Output – Rated 65 W for rapid charging.
-
Multiple USB-C Output Levels – 5 V/5 A, 9 V/5 A, 12 V/5 A, 15 V/4.3 A, 20 V/3.25 A.
-
USB-A Output – 5 V, 2 A for legacy devices or accessories.
-
Temperature Safe Operation – 5° to 40° C (41° to 104° F).
-
Quick Charge DJI Mavic 3 Battery – Approximately 1 hour 36 minutes.
-
Quick Charge DJI Avata 2 Battery – Approximately 47 minutes.
-
Charge DJI Goggles 2 – Approximately 1 hour 50 minutes.
